Comprehending Car Key Programming

Car key programming is the procedure of syncing a replacement key's internal transponder or clever chip with the automobile's On-Board Computer (OBC) or Engine Control Unit (ECU). Without this synchronization, the automobile's immobilizer system will avoid the engine from starting, even if the physical blade fits the ignition lock cylinder perfectly.

The Role of the Transponder Chip

Introduced in the mid-1990s, the transponder chip is a small electronic element embedded in the plastic head of a key. When a chauffeur attempts to start the automobile, the ignition sends out a radio frequency signal to the key. The chip reacts with a distinct recognition code. If the ECU recognizes this code, the immobilizer is shut off, and the car begins. If the code is missing or inaccurate, the fuel system stays locked.

Common Types of Programmable Car Keys

As vehicle security has advanced, a number of various types of secrets have gone into the market. Each needs a specific approach to programming.

  • Transponder Keys: These appear like standard secrets however include a concealed chip. They normally need a specialized diagnostic tool to link the chip to the car.
  • Remote Keyless Entry (RKE) Fobs: These are handheld devices that lock and unlock doors through radio waves. While they may not begin the car, they still require programming to communicate with the door actuators.
  • Integrated Remote Keys: These combine the physical key blade with the remote buttons in one system.
  • Smart Keys/Proximity Fobs: Found in automobiles with "push-to-start" buttons, these keys interact continuously with the car. The automobile detects the key's existence within a particular radius, allowing the driver to operate the car without ever getting rid of the key from their pocket.

The Programming Process: How It Is Done

While the precise steps vary by maker, the process normally follows one of 2 paths: Onboard Programming or OBD-II Diagnostic Programming.

1. Onboard Programming (Self-Programming)

Some manufacturers, particularly older models from Ford, Chrysler, and General Motors, enable owners to program keys using a sequence of actions. This may include turning the ignition on and off numerous times or holding down specific buttons on the control panel.

2. OBD-II Diagnostic Programming

Many modern lorries require a specialist to connect a tablet or computer to the On-Board Diagnostic (OBD-II) port. Using specific software, the service technician accesses the lorry's security module to "teach" the car the new key's ID. This is frequently an encrypted process that requires an active web connection to the manufacturer's server.

Professional locksmiths and specialized DIYers make use of numerous tools to make sure a successful match in between the key and the car.

  • Key Cutting Machines: Used to mirror the physical grooves of the initial key or cut by code.
  • Transponder Programmers: Handheld devices that read and compose data to the chip.
  • OBD-II Scanners: Advanced diagnostic tools that user interface with the ECU.
  • EEPROM Readers: Used in "all keys lost" circumstances where the lorry's computer should be physically accessed to read data directly from a circuit board.
Fixing Common Programming Issues

Sometimes, a key may fail to program correctly. Identifying the origin is essential for a resolution.

  • Incorrect Key Frequency: Even if a key looks identical, it needs to run on the right frequency (typically 315MHz or 433MHz).
  • Battery Issues: A weak battery in a remote or smart key can avoid the signal from being strong enough to complete the pairing procedure.
  • Optimum Key Limit: Many automobiles have a limit on how lots of secrets can be set (often 4 or 8). If the limitation is reached, older secrets must be eliminated before a brand-new one can be included.
  • Aftermarket Quality: Cheap secrets acquired online might lack the needed internal circuitry or consist of "locked" chips that can not be reprogrammed.
Regularly Asked Questions (FAQ)

Can I set a car key myself?

It depends upon the car. Some older Domestic and Asian models enable onboard programming if the owner already has a couple of working secrets. Nevertheless, a lot of cars produced after 2010 require specific diagnostic devices.

The length of time does it take to set a car key?

When the specialist has the proper key and access to the automobile, the programming process normally takes between 15 and 30 minutes. Some high-security European designs may use up to an hour due to the time needed for the software application to bypass security wait times.

Will a locksmith professional's key work along with the dealership's?

Yes. Expert vehicle locksmith professionals utilize premium aftermarket or Original Equipment Manufacturer (OEM) keys that are functionally similar to those sold at a dealer.

What info is needed to get a key programmed?

A professional will usually need the car's year, make, and model, as well as the Vehicle Identification Number (VIN). Evidence of ownership, such as a registration or title, is also compulsory for security factors.

Can an utilized key from another car be reprogrammed?

Generally, no. Most modern transponder chips "lock" to the very first lorry they are set to. While some remotes can be cleared and recycled, most proximity fobs and transponder keys are "one-time write" gadgets.
